Dhaka: Dhaka University Central Students’ Union (DUCSU) leaders today held a meeting with Chinese Ambassador to Bangladesh Yao Wen at the Chinese Embassy in the city.



According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, the meeting was held at the invitation of the Chinese ambassador and was attended by DUCSU’s newly appointed Treasurer and Chairman of the Department of Finance, Prof Dr. H. M. Mosharraf Hossain, representing DUCSU President DU VC Prof Niaz Ahmed Khan.



During the meeting, the DUCSU leaders discussed various issues and expressed their desire for joint cooperation in multiple areas, including the infrastructural development of Dhaka University and enhancing student residential facilities.



A key topic of discussion was the construction of the proposed China-Bangladesh Friendship Hall, which will accommodate 5,000 female students, with construction expected to begin this year. The DUCSU representatives also proposed building two additional halls for students, and the ambassador assured them of joint cooperation in a second phase.



Ambassador Yao Wen expressed his interest in fostering mutual collaboration through various initiatives in the fields of science and technology, sports, health, scholarships, research, and culture.



At the end of the meeting, the DUCSU representatives presented a memento to the ambassador, and he, in turn, gave gifts to the elected DUCSU leaders.
